The Arizona Cardinals, facing some depth concerns in the defensive backfield, made some moves on their practice squad on Wednesday. With safety Kitan Crawford landing on injured reserve and cornerback Kalen King getting signed from the practice squad to the active roster, the Cardinals added two defensive backs.
They released receiver Ihmir Smith-Marsette, giving them two spots to fill, and signed cornerback Art Green and safety Jerrick Reed II.
Green played the last two seasons for the New York Giants, appearing in 20 games. He played over 200 special teams snaps in both seasons.
Reed was a 2023 sixth-round draft pick of the Seattle Seahawks and has played for Seattle and the Tennessee Titans. In three seasons, he has appeared in 23 games, including
one start.
